Object Details
Country of Origin United States of America Type PERSONAL EQUIPMENT-Helmets & Headwear Manufacturer Sierra Manufacturing Co.
Physical Description United States Air Force Type HGU-2A/P protective flying helmet; white fibreglass plastic shell with light brown leather padding; exterior of helmet covered with olive drab, green, black, and brown camoflaged tape; gray green plastic sunvisor with white plastic protective housing and blue plastic locking knob; white nylon adjustable chin strap; internal headphones with gray plastic padding; black external microphone attachment Dimensions 3-D: 25.4 x 25.4 x 25.4cm (10 x 10 x 10 in.)
Clothing Size: Large
Materials Shell: Plastic
Visor: Plastic
Lining: Leather
Chin Strap: Nylon
